UN Security Council meeting on the situation in the Middle East (Iran)

Mar 12, 2026 | News and Media

At today’s vote on a UNSC draft Res. on Iranian attacks, submitted by Bahrein on behalf of GCC/ Jordan, adopted with 13 votes and garnering the impressive support of 135 member states, the Permanent Representative of Greece:

↪ Stressed that Greece was among the first to cosponsor and voted in favour of the GCC/Jordan Resolution.

↪ Reiterated her strong condemnation of the Iranian strikes against countries in the Gulf region and elsewhere.

↪ Expressed Greece’s deep concern for the ongoing military escalation in the region.

↪ Urged all parties to exercise maximum restraint and to reopen credible channels of dialogue.

↪ Cautioned against the alarming consequences of this conflict on maritime security, global trade and energy supply.
